The proposed wall, marked in red, deliberately left open the border regions near the Rio Grande, as well as particularly treacherous desert and mountain terrain. Because migrants would be forced to contend with the dangerous elements in these gaps, natural barriers seemed to offer an equally effective anti-immigration plan. Indeed, almost 450 migrants died while trying to cross in 2014 alone.
